要将 ChatGPT Next Web 部署到自己的云服务器上,可以按照以下步骤进行:
在云服务器上安装 Docker 和 Docker Compose。具体操作可以参考官方文档或者搜索相关教程。
在云服务器上创建一个目录来存放 ChatGPT Next Web 项目的文件。
使用 Git 克隆 ChatGPT Next Web 项目到该目录中。命令如下:
git clone https://github.com/yidadaa/ChatGPT-next-web.git
- 进入刚刚克隆下来的 ChatGPT Next Web 目录,编辑
.env
文件,填写 OpenAI API Key 和聊天室密码等信息。命令如下:
cd ChatGPT-next-web
nano .env
- 在 ChatGPT Next Web 目录中运行以下命令启动容器:
docker-compose up -d
- 容器启动后,就可以通过浏览器访问 http://
:3000 来使用 ChatGPT Next Web 了。
其中 <server_ip>
是你的云服务器 IP 地址。如果需要修改容器端口号,可在 docker-compose.yml
文件中修改。
注意:部署前请确保 OpenAI API Key 和聊天室密码等敏感信息已正确填写,并且云服务器开启了对应端口(默认为3000)的访问权限。